From 4eee5042f310d0a802b1354dc87f5b0362cb1d07 Mon Sep 17 00:00:00 2001 From: jiangjiazhi Date: Thu, 18 Aug 2016 15:46:33 +0800 Subject: [PATCH] =?UTF-8?q?=E5=A2=9E=E5=8A=A0=E8=AE=BE=E7=BD=AEparentid?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- .../java/com/lyms/platform/common/dao/operator/MongoCondition.java | 6 +++++- 1 file changed, 5 insertions(+), 1 deletion(-) diff --git a/platform-common/src/main/java/com/lyms/platform/common/dao/operator/MongoCondition.java b/platform-common/src/main/java/com/lyms/platform/common/dao/operator/MongoCondition.java index 5a03d10..e3e8050 100644 --- a/platform-common/src/main/java/com/lyms/platform/common/dao/operator/MongoCondition.java +++ b/platform-common/src/main/java/com/lyms/platform/common/dao/operator/MongoCondition.java @@ -192,7 +192,11 @@ public class MongoCondition { criteria.all(obj); } }else if(MongoOper.IN==oper){ - criteria.in(obj); + if (obj instanceof Collection) { + criteria.in((Collection) obj); + }else { + criteria.in(obj); + } } } -- 1.8.3.1